1. A method for controlling a multimedia device, which includes an area based touch sensor, the method comprising the steps of:

  • performing at least one mode in the multimedia device;

    recognizing at least a palm or a finger of a user through a touch sensor;

    determining at least a shape, a size or a number of fingers of a touched area in accordance with the recognized result of the touch sensor;

    accessing a specific function stored in a memory module in accordance with the determined result and a type of the at least one mode;

    outputting at least video data or audio data corresponding to the accessed specific function,wherein the determining step further includes merging at least one node within a detected area to another node,wherein the merging step further includes extracting a distance between three adjacent nodes (a distance between a first node and a second node is D1, a distance between the second node and a third node is D2, and a distance between the third node and the first node is D3) and estimating the three nodes to be one node if D2 is greater than D1, D2 is less than a previously set value, and D3 is greater than the previously set value,wherein the determining the number of fingers further includesif an edge point of the touched area becomes farther away in a counterclockwise direction from a start point, firstly estimating it to be a positive value or a negative value, wherein the start point is decided by a minimum Y position value and a maximum X position value at the minimum Y position of the touched area,if the edge point of the touched area becomes closer to the start point in the same counterclockwise direction, secondly estimating it to be a negative value or a positive value opposite to the firstly estimated value,estimating an interval where positive numbers and negative numbers are repeated to be one period, andestimating the number of fingers within the touched area to be a number of periods.
